Achieve maximum performance and optimal sound quality from your ELAC Reference speakers with proper speaker placement and set-up. While not all rooms are the same, use the following guidelines to configure the speakers for your particular room. There are no "exact" rules or boundaries in setting up your speakers but the following suggestions will help optimize your desired results. Remember the best sound set-up is what sounds best for you so don't be afraid to experiment and make adjustments to the placement and directivity of the speakers.
Place the speakers approximately one to two feet away (fig. 1) from boundaries such as wall(s) and especially corners. Close proximity to a side or rear wall will enhance bass performance (output), but being too close (particularly to a corner) may result in bass that is unnatural. If a corner location is unavoidable, try to position the loudspeaker so that the distance to the rear wall is not equal to the distance to the side wall.
Whether you use the DBR62 bookshelf or the DFR52 floorstanding speakers for a 5.1-channel surround set-up, avoid placing the surround speakers forward of your listening position. The surround speakers should be spread apart wider than the front speakers. In addition, elevate the speakers to the same height or slightly higher as the front speakers for the most enveloping sound field. Like the front speakers, you may need to experiment with the positioning by pointing the rear surround speakers towards the listening area.
The ELAC DCR52 center channel speaker is designed to produce dialog sounds and should be positioned above or below (fig. 3) your television. Align it with the center of the television. As much as possible, try to keep the DCR52 close to the same level (height) as your front speakers for a more even sound stage. Keeping the same height for the center channel can be very challenging so it might be necessary to tilt the center speaker up (if too low) or down (if too high), to aim it towards the listening area.
Optimal results for the center are obtained by setting the receiver/processor center channel size to small. If you have a choice, set the crossover frequency to 80Hz.
Model | DBR62 Bookshelf Speaker | DCR52 Center Channel Speaker | DFR52 Floorstanding Speaker |
Enclosure Type | 2-Way Bass Reflex | 2 - Way Bass Reflex | 3-Way Bass Reflex |
Frequency Response | 44Hz - 35000Hz | 55Hz - 35000hz | 42Hz - 35000Hz |
Nominal Impedance | 6 Ohms | 8 Ohms | 6 Ohms |
Sensitivity | 86db @ 2.83v/1m | 87db @ 2.83v/1m | 87db @ 2.83v/1m |
Crossover Frequency | 2200Hz | 2200Hz | 90hz/2200Hz |
Max Power Input | 120 Watts | 120 Watts | 140 Watts |
Tweeter | 1" Cloth Dome | 1" Cloth Dome | 1" Cloth Dome |
Midrange | n/a | n/a | 5.25 Inch Aramid Fiber |
Woofer | 6.5 Inch Aramid Fiber | 2 x 5.25 Inch Aramid Fiber | 2 x 5.25 Inch Aramid Fiber |
Cabinet | CARB2 Rated MDF | CARB2 Rated MDF | CARB2 Rated MDF |
Cabinet Finish | White Baffle, Oak Cabinet or Black Baffle, Wallnut Cabinet | White Baffle, Oak Cabinet or Black Baffle, Wallnut Cabinet | White Baffle, Oak Cabinet or Black Baffle, Wallnut Cabinet |
Port | Dual Flared | 3 x Dual Flared | 3 x Dual Flared |
Binding Posts | 5-Way Metal | 5-Way Metal | 5-Way Metal |
Dimensions (WxHxD) | 8.18" x 10.82" x 14.13" | 20.74" x 9.52" x 7.28" | 7.28" x 9.52" x 39.99" |
Weight (lb / Kg) | 18.07 / 8.2 | 22.26 / 10.1 | 36.81 / 16.7 |
Please ensure the product is perfectly stable to avoid injury from tip-over. Please note, that stability can be increased by using spikes on carpeted surfaces. However, the mounting of spikes must be carried out carefully due to their very sharp ends which may cause injuries. The stability on slippery floors can be increased by using Velcro fastening tape or double-sided adhesive tape. Do not install the speaker near any heat sources such as radiators, heating valves, stoves, or other apparatus (including amplifiers) that produce heat, or in areas where there is a risk of explosion.
